It does now. I just saw it for the first time just now.

Honestly, it's an improvement. Google has been pushing Chat into the Gmail client for a while. It makes it super cluttered and hard to see your labels (aka folders), especially on a small screen. Generally, the reading view has always been too wide, way past the recommended number of characters in a line. You have to reduce the window size to read any email with long paragraphs, so on most screens, giving up width in the reading area is not an issue. But cluttering up the folders sidebar with chat made the whole thing difficult to use. Much better now.
